Detroit City Council members expect to vote Wednesday afternoon on a consent agreement to keep Governor Snyder from appointing an emergency financial manager for the city. The council didn't vote on the deal Tuesday, citing legal battles over the agreement. Deputy Mayor Kirk Lewis says he appreciates the council's seriousness, but warns that the governor may appoint an emergency manager if the council doesn't act soon. Thursday is Snyder's deadline for the city to accept an agreement. WDET's Pat Batcheller spoke with Councilmember Saunteel Jenkins on Wednesday morning.
